What's Happening?
Darius Garland, the Cleveland Cavaliers' star guard, is officially listed as questionable for the upcoming game against the Philadelphia 76ers. Garland has been recovering from offseason toe surgery and has yet
to make his season debut. His potential return could significantly impact the team's dynamics, particularly affecting Lonzo Ball's playing time. If Garland is cleared to play, he may be subject to a minutes restriction to ensure a gradual return to full fitness.
